On 12/3/22 18:30, Piergiorgio Beruto wrote:
> Add support for configuring the PLCA Reconciliation Sublayer on
> multi-drop PHYs that support IEEE802.3cg-2019 Clause 148 (e.g.,
> 10BASE-T1S). This patch adds the appropriate netlink interface
> to ethtool.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Piergiorgio Beruto <piergiorgio.beruto@gmail.com>
> ---


> diff --git a/drivers/net/phy/phy.c b/drivers/net/phy/phy.c
> index e5b6cb1a77f9..99e3497b6aa1 100644
> --- a/drivers/net/phy/phy.c
> +++ b/drivers/net/phy/phy.c
> @@ -543,6 +543,40 @@ int phy_ethtool_get_stats(struct phy_device *phydev,
>  }
>  EXPORT_SYMBOL(phy_ethtool_get_stats);
>  

What is the meaning of all these empty kernel-doc comment blocks?
Why are they here?
Please delete them.
